Transaction 3429693d6c442be6f63d7d1c3da200b326ff6a33c9b91fa41514b97f4357b1d6
1 Input
1 Output
-
3429693d6c442be6f63d7d1c3da200b326ff6a33c9b91fa41514b97f4357b1d6:0
- value
- 2238781
- script pubkey
- OP_0 OP_PUSHBYTES_20 90781f358209138e15fc6b531819dd32beacfc7f
- address
- bc1qjpup7dvzpyfcu90uddf3sxwax2l2elrlza20yt